Baby Jacquards - Ruffle Edge Blanket (knit)

Skill Level
Easy

This delicate ruffled baby blanket is worked according to the pattern changes in the yarn rather than by length, for a uniform and clean finished project.

MEASUREMENTS: Approx 30 ins [76 cm] square.

MATERIALS
Bernat® Baby Jacquards (
100 g /3.5 oz; 316 m/346 yds)
06201 (Bluebell) 4 balls

Size 4.5 mm (U.S. 7) circular knitting needle 24 ins [60 cm] long. Size 4.5 mm (U.S. 7) knitting needles or size needed to obtain gauge.

GAUGE: 21 sts and 28 rows = 4 ins [10 cm] in stocking st.

INSTRUCTIONS
Note
: Bernat® Baby Jacquards is designed to create stripes and jacquard effect fabric as you knit. There are long sections of solid colors in stepping shades from light to dark then back to light, each approx 15 yds [14 m] long. The printed jacquard sections are also approx 15 yds [14 m] long. When joining a new ball of yarn, match color of new yarn to previous ball for pattern continuity.
Beg with dark solid color section and circular needle, cast on 126 sts. Do not join. Working back and forth across needle, proceed in stocking st until at least 1 full row of light solid color section after a jacquard section has been worked, ending with a purl row.
Note: Box Stitch Pat to be worked using solid colors. Stocking st to be worked using printed jacquard section of yarn.
**1st row: (RS). K2. *P2. K2. Rep from * to end of row.
2nd row: P2. *K2. P2. Rep from * to end of row.
3rd row: As 2nd row.
4th row: As 1st row.
Rep these 4 rows of Box Stitch Pat once more.
Work approx 6 or 8 rows in stocking st, ending with at least 1 full row of light solid color section after jacquard section has been worked and a purl row.**
Rep from ** to ** until work from beg measures approx 24 ins [61 cm], ending with dark color section and a purl row. Cast off. Border: With pair of needles, cast on 17 sts.
1st row: (RS). Knit.
2nd row: P14. Turn. Leave rem sts unworked.
3rd row: Sl1P. K13.
4th row: P14. K3.
5th row: K3. P14.
6th row: K14. Turn. Leave rem sts unworked.
7th row: Sl1P. P13.
8th row: Knit.
Rep these 8 rows for pat until Border measures length to fit around entire Blanket, gathering at corners. Cast off.
Beg at center of one side, sew shorter edge of Border in position using flat seam. Sew side seams of Border.
